Month-by-month
| Month | Temp °C | Feels °C | Rain days | Rain h | Rain h/day | Humidity | Wind km/h | Sun h | UV | Interest | Score |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Jan | -1–5 | 1 | 13 | 187 | 14.4 | 79% | 17 | 75 | 1 | Quiet | 3 |
| Feb | 1–8 | 4 | 15 | 189 | 12.6 | 72% | 20 | 107 | 1 | Quiet | 4 |
| Mar | 1–11 | 8 | 11 | 133 | 12.1 | 59% | 17 | 184 | 2 | Quiet | 6 |
| Apr | 3–14 | 11 | 11 | 133 | 12.1 | 55% | 17 | 210 | 3 | Quiet | 6 |
| May | 9–19 | 17 | 15 | 157 | 10.5 | 54% | 16 | 245 | 4 | Quiet | 7 |
| Jun | 13–24 | 24 | 11 | 120 | 10.9 | 52% | 15 | 269 | 6 | Quiet | 9 |
| Jul | 14–25 | 25 | 12 | 125 | 10.4 | 51% | 15 | 277 | 5 | Quiet | 8 |
| Aug | 15–25 | 25 | 13 | 151 | 11.6 | 57% | 14 | 247 | 5 | Busy | 8 |
| Sep | 11–21 | 20 | 11 | 112 | 10.2 | 62% | 13 | 213 | 3 | Moderate | 8 |
| Oct | 7–16 | 14 | 11 | 137 | 12.5 | 72% | 14 | 149 | 2 | Moderate | 6 |
| Nov | 2–8 | 6 | 12 | 149 | 12.4 | 80% | 15 | 90 | 1 | Peak | 4 |
| Dec | 0–5 | 2 | 14 | 196 | 14.0 | 83% | 15 | 62 | 1 | Busy | 3 |

Frequently asked questions about visiting Nuremberg
When is the best time to visit Nuremberg?
June is the highest-scoring month (9/10 on the Holiday Climate Index). Typical conditions: 13–24°C (11 rainy days). The top three months by score are June, July, September.
What is the worst time to visit Nuremberg?
December is the lowest-scoring month (3/10). Typical conditions: 0–5°C (14 rainy days).
When are crowds lowest in Nuremberg?
Search-interest seasonality (Google Trends 2021-2025) is lowest in January and peaks in November. Interest tracks both in-trip visitors and lead-time planners, so treat it as a "destination is on people's minds" signal rather than literal arrivals.

Is air quality in Nuremberg bad for travelers?
PM2.5 (fine-particle pollution) exceeds the WHO sensitive-group guideline (15 µg/m³) in 6 months: January, February, March, October, November, December. The worst month is February with a typical-day mean of 13 µg/m³ (moderate); on the worst 10% of days PM2.5 reaches 22 µg/m³ (unhealthy for sensitive) and higher. People with asthma, heart conditions, or sensitive children may want to avoid these months or limit outdoor activity. Source: CAMS via Open-Meteo.
